Web12. jul 2024. · To map a network share, run a command similar to the one below: New-PSDrive -Name "N" -PSProvider "FileSystem" -Root "\\DESKTOP-SIAQMO1\Log Files" The Name is like the drive letter. Change this to whatever you want. The name can also be a word. Web19. jan 2024. · Now you can use the following code to map a drive. using IWshRuntimeLibrary; IWshNetwork_Class network = new IWshNetwork_Class (); network.MapNetworkDrive ("k:",@"\\192.168.20.35\MyShare", Type.Missing, "user1", "password1"); you can use the following code to UnMap or remove the mapping. Web10. dec 2004. · Set objNetwork = CreateObject(“Wscript.Network”) objNetwork.MapNetworkDrive “X:”, “\\atl-fs-01\finance” All we have to do is create an instance of the WSH Network object, then call the MapNetworkDrive method, passing the method two parameters: the drive letter, and the file share we want to map to.
